About this item
- Pre-loaded with ISO 400 speed film with 27 exposures per camera
- Built-in 10’ flash range and a continuous flash switch
- 2 pack - Total 54 exposures

- HonuloveEasy to use camera - even for Gen Alpha!I bought these for my daughter (Gen Alpha) to use at a week long camp where electronics were banned. Seeing that she had never used a point and shoot film camera, I was shocked she knew how to use it without instruction. She was able to wind it and take her pictures using the flash. Our only challenge now is how to get the film developed. It’s challenging to find places that don’t charge a car payment to develop. It’s a nice reality check for her to have to wait to see a picture like I used to do. I’m glad they still make these so there’s still an opportunity to capture memories during times when no electronics are allowed. We’ll see how the pictures turn out!
